Friday, October 20: Cultural Exploration in Chinatown
Immerse yourself in the vibrant culture of Singapore's Chinatown. Start the day by visiting Sri Mariamman Temple, the oldest Hindu temple in Singapore. Explore the colorful streets lined with traditional shop houses and visit the Buddha Tooth Relic Temple. In the afternoon, enjoy a relaxing river cruise along the Singapore River. As the evening comes, indulge in delicious street food at Chinatown Food Street and explore the night market atmosphere.
Sri Mariamman Temple: Free, Time Spent - 30 minutes
Buddha Tooth Relic Temple: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
Singapore River Cruise: Estimated Cost - $25 (adult), $15 (child), Time Spent - 45 minutes
Chinatown Food Street: Estimated Cost - $10-20 per meal,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
Restaurants
Start your morning with a delicious breakfast at Tong Ah Eating House, a local favorite known for its traditional kaya toast and silky soft-boiled eggs. Average cost for a meal is about $5 per person.
For lunch, head over to Maxwell Food Centre and try Tian Tian Hainanese Chicken Rice, famous for its succulent chicken and fragrant rice. Average cost for a meal is about $6 per person.
Indulge in a mouthwatering dinner at Liao Fan Hawker Chan, the world's cheapest Michelin-starred meal. Don't miss their signature soya sauce chicken rice. Average cost for a meal is about $8 per person.

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ites
If you have extra time, consider visiting the Singapore Botanic Gardens,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, and enjoy a leisurely picnic amidst lush greenery. For a unique cultural experience, explore the vibrant neighborhood of Kampong Glam, home to the historic Sultan Mosque and colorful Haji Lane lined with quirky boutiques and cafes. Families will also enjoy a visit to the ArtScience Museum, which combines art and science in interactive exhibits.
